Was just in Fillmore, CA: The Fillmore & Western Rwy. has just acquired some of CA & AZ Rwy locomotives: (GP35, GP30) to go along with its F’s and Alcos (RS-32, S-2,4). The good news is you can get within a few feet of them, either on Mt. View Ave., or along the city’s promenade (sidewalk) that runs along the right-of-way east of Fillmore City Hall.
While you’re there, check out the Historical Society’s displays and equipment, then go across Mt. View to see and ride with Ventura County Live Steamers 1-1/2" scale live steam trains on the first Sunday of each month.
